The Yearning for Complete Devotion in 'Tu Unico Dueño'

Uriel Lozano's song 'Tu Unico Dueño' is a heartfelt declaration of love and desire for complete unity with a significant other. The lyrics express a deep yearning to be an integral part of the beloved's life, encompassing every aspect of their existence. Lozano's words paint a vivid picture of a love so intense that it seeks to permeate every moment and experience of the loved one, from their dreams to their waking moments.

The song employs rich metaphors to convey this desire for unity. For instance, the singer wishes to be 'the blood that escapes through your veins' and 'the sun that enters your bed,' symbolizing an intimate and essential presence in the beloved's life. These metaphors highlight the depth of the singer's longing to be indispensable and ever-present, reflecting a love that is both nurturing and consuming.

Culturally, 'Tu Unico Dueño' resonates with themes of romantic idealism and passionate devotion, common in Latin music. Uriel Lozano, known for his romantic ballads, uses his emotive vocal style to enhance the song's emotional impact. The repetition of phrases like 'ser tu sueño en la almohada' (to be your dream on the pillow) and 'ser tu amante a escondidas' (to be your secret lover) underscores the singer's desire to be both a comforting and thrilling presence in the beloved's life. This duality of peace and excitement encapsulates the essence of a profound and multifaceted love.
